Adapt profile management to users with no usable passwordi (fixes #10787).

This commit is contained in:
Mikaël Ates 2016-05-02 09:38:30 +02:00
parent 1212b28ff1
commit ff044e8b0d
1 changed files with 9 additions and 1 deletions

View File

@ -43,7 +43,15 @@ Gestion du compte
<h2>Gestion du compte</h2>
<ul>
<li><a href="{% url 'email-change' %}">Modifier le courriel associé</a></li>
<li><a href="{% url 'password_change' %}">Modifier le mot de passe</a></li>
<li>
<a href="{% url 'password_change' %}">
{% if user.has_usable_password %}
Modifier le mot de passe
{% else %}
Définir le mot de passe
{% endif %}
</a>
</li>
<li><a href="{% url 'profile_edit' %}">Éditer les données du compte</a></li>
<li><a href="{% url 'delete_account' %}">Supprimer le compte</a></li>
</ul>